Squatwatch detected a newly published package whose name is within edit distance one of an internal Brindle Systems dependency. Install counts are nonzero inside the Pellgrove build fleet. The package has been quarantined pending review. Verify the flagged name against the allowlist, check install provenance, and confirm no postinstall scripts executed. Triage steps and the quarantine queue live at the page below.

operations page: https://jenkins.zemvarcloud.local/job/merge_requests/repo/build/73930b4b30f0a8ed

## Service Accounts for Plugin Authors

If your plugin wants to run feeds through the Chirpline validator, you'll need a service account rather than a personal login — it keeps rate limits sane and makes audits painless. Accounts are scoped to validation-only, so you can't touch publishing endpoints. Spin one up from the developer console, then authenticate against the internal validation gateway using the key below.

gateway credential: zpat3_i6x

Subject: Tracing setup for the Quillbrook integration

Hi, and welcome aboard. As you wire your services into the Quillbrook mesh, please propagate our trace header on every outbound call, including retries — dropped headers are the main reason spans appear orphaned in the Lanternview dashboard. Sampling is set to 20% in staging, so don't panic if some requests vanish. To query the trace API directly while you're validating your integration, authenticate with the token below.

login token, yagaf-hawip: eyJhbGciOiJIUzI1NiIsInR5cCI6IkpXVCJ9.eyJzdWIiOiIdHjlcNIn0.AFyH-u9q

## Changelog — Paylark Export v4.2

Default payroll export format changed from fixed-width to CSV-with-header. Downstream consumers at the Brindle office reported parse failures on the old layout, so CSV is now the default for all new tenants. Existing tenants keep their configured format until the next sync window. Rollback: set the format flag back and restart the export worker. No schema changes otherwise. Keep an eye on the dead-letter queue for the first two runs. Current service configuration follows.

config for fahap-badup:
[ralath]
port = 3000
region = lower-2
host = ralath.tolvaqsys.corp
timeout_ms = 3000
retries = 4